JZero Solutions Releases JLMS Enterprise 5.2.3

London (UK), July 2015 - JZero Solutions has announced that many new features have been released into the JLMS Enterprise platform, giving customers much more flexibility and functionality.

The features that have been released include

  • content tagging, allowing learners to add keywords to content to make searching easier for other learners
  • course compliance options, where eLearning courses can be set to refresh after a set period of time once the course has been completed by the user, with previous usage being archived to retain the training audit trail
  • manager dashboard options, where you can choose between having a standard snapshot data view or a compliance-training view for your managers
  • waitlist/register interest classroom training courses, so that dates do not need to be set against a course for users to be able to add themselves to the list of interested learners
  • learning plan and learning tracker, which are two different views of a user’s plan
  • custom navigation, which allows administrators to add in custom system pages and html content of their own to create a new page
  • content review gives learners the ability to rate a course and provide a written review
  • administration updates that give much more flexibility to configure JLMS Enterprise to a customer’s specific requirements
